1 killed, 3 seriously injured in 4-vehicle crash near Menora Tunnel
One of the four vehicles involved in a crash at Km 263.3 of the North-South Expressway (southbound) near Menora Tunnel in Perak today. – Bernama pic, May 2, 2021

IPOH – A local man was killed and three others sustained serious injuries in an accident involving four vehicles at Km 263.3 of the North-South Expressway (southbound) near Menora Tunnel here today.

Meru Fire and Rescue Station chief Shahrudi Muhamad Halil said they received a call around 3.56pm about an incident involving three cars and a motorcycle.

The crash killed a 40-year-old man, K. Nagantheran, he added.

He said two men and a woman sustained serious injuries, while another victim suffered light wounds. Six other victims are unhurt.

“Fire and rescue personnel who arrived at the scene extricated a man trapped in a car using special equipment.

“Other victims were removed by the public before we arrived,” he said in a statement today.

The rescue operation ended at 5pm, and all the victims have been sent to Raja Permaisuri Bainun Hospital, he added.

Meanwhile, Shahrudi said a victim – the driver of a Perodua Myvi – died in the hospital emergency ward this evening.

According to him, the victim, who was identified as Maryamah Talib, 52, of Lengkok Tasek Barat 1A, Taman Anda, here, was the sister of a sergeant attached to the Ipoh district police headquarters.

He said the remains of the victim, a teaching staff of a private hospital here, will be sent for post-mortem. – Bernama, May 2, 2021
